7.1.1 Zone Status
Color coding is used to display the status of each zone.
Grey indicates the zone is turned Off.
Black indicates the zone temperature is outside of the specified limits.
Green indicates the zone temperature is inside the specified limits.
Blue indicates the zone is in Standby mode.
Orange indicates the zone is in Boost mode.
7.1.2 Zone Information Fields
Figure 7-2 Single Zone (Zone from 6 Zone Layout)
1. Zone Name 2. Zone Number 3. Power Output Bar 4. Actual Temperature 5. Setpoint
6. Power Output 7. Amps 8. Volts 9. Watts
Field Description
Zone Name The user defined name of the zone.
Zone Number The number of the zone. This is a static field.
Power Output Bar This graphic displays the power output applied to the zone. Each line within
the bar indicates a 25% increment.
Actual Temperature The actual temperature being read by the thermocouple. If the zone is Off,
OFF is displayed.
Setpoint The zone setpoint for the current mode.
Power Output The power output percentage applied to the zone.
Amps The actual current being used by the heater. This is not displayed if the
system is configured with XL-Series cards.
Volts The actual voltage being delivered to the heater. This is directly related to the
supply voltage feeding the Altanium mainframe. This is not displayed if the
system is configured with XL-Series cards.
Watts The actual wattage being used by the heater. This is not displayed if the
system is configured with XL-Series cards.
